WebMay 3, 2024 · The force of gravity attracts objects in space to each other — causing the motion of one object to continually bend toward another. Throughout the cosmos, all sorts of celestial objects orbit each other. Moons and spacecraft orbit planets. Comets and asteroids orbit the sun — even other planets.
